Lanap
Dr. Moss is licensed to practice the laser assisted new attachment procedure (LANAP™), a minimally invasive method of treating gum disease. LANAP is a laser-assisted procedure certified by the FDA for treatment of periodontitis or gum disease. You may have heard about or experienced the remarkable results from laser treatments for vision correction and other medical procedures. Now, that same technology is revolutionizing dentistry! With LANAP, gum disease can be treated successfully without scalpels or sutures, so healing and recovery is faster and less painful than traditional gum surgery. Tekscan
The way your teeth align when you bite down is very important to a lot of dental work, including crowns, bridges, and implants. Even if you’re not having any work done, your alignment is still important and could be leading to soreness in your jaw and muscles, or causing you to grind your teeth. In the past, dentists used a piece of carbon paper to determine the strength of your bite in different places. However, this was not always that effective because your teeth do not all bite down at the same time and a problem even the thickness of a single hair can cause issues. Now, Dr. Moss uses TekScan, which displays a time-elapsed chart of bite strength to pinpoint the precise problems in your bite. This allows us to make better adjustments and help all of your dental work last as long as possible!
Water Laser
With the breakthrough WaterLase it is now possible to have a virtually pain-free dental visit! In most cases this replaces shots and drills for many of the procedures you would need during your visit. Its focused energy dissipates tooth decay and saving you from more expensive and painful procedures, such as crowns and root canals. Unlike old techniques it does not create micro-cracks as it works, and even sterilizes the tooth during the process. It will leave you with less pain, trauma, bleeding and swelling.

Carifree
Cavities are caused by a bacterial infection known as “caries,” which we now know are not only treatable, but preventable. Dr. Moss uses the CariFree ™ program, developed to help patients become cavity-free by assessing risks, diagnosing bacterial caries and treating the infection using preventive techniques. During your visit you will receive a “caries risk assessment” to evaluate whether you have factors present that can put you at risk for decay. You will then be given instructions and the at-home products needed to keep you and your family cavity free.

Digital X-Rays
Dr. Moss is thrilled to offer his patients digital x-rays in place of the traditional techniques. This new technology means less exposure to radiation and less wait time for development. We can show you right on the screen what the problems are and help you better understand your treatment.
